Only £29.95 for 12 months web access and the print magazine. Nestle is subject to the world's longest running boycott for the irresponsible marketing of baby milk to mothers in the developing world. Although the minimum wage in an at-will employment agreement is legal, those working for minimum wage often cannot manage their day-to-day expenses, leaving them buried in debt and bitter toward th⦠Labor practices are often a hot-button issue from an ethical perspective, and labor laws tend to lag behind popular sentiment, leaving room for companies to employ legal practices that their customers and employees may find unethical. For over 20 years Baby Milk Action has called a boycott of the company for its irresponsible marketing of baby milk formula, which infringes the International Code of Marketing of Breast-milk Substitutes.
